CINCINNATI, Ohio - On Sunday, December 12th your Mount St. Joseph University Lions welcomed the Chargers of Ancilla College and the University of Rio Grande Red Storm to the Harrington Center for the first home meet of the season. The Lions squared off against Ancilla to begin the meet and were unstoppable. The Mount won every match defeating the Chargers 58-0. After Ancilla and Rio Grande battled the Lions took on the Red Storm. Again, the Lions were dominant taking all but two matches defeating Rio Grande 44-9.
MSJ - 58 Ancilla College - 0
Ancilla College only wrestled in four weight classes forfeiting in the 125lb, 133lb, 149lb, 157lb, 165lb, and 174lb weight classes.
Desmond Diggs (Xenia, Ohio/Xenia) got things started for the Lions with a major decision victory of 16-8 in the 141lb weight class. Following Diggs was
Antonio McCloud (Cincinnati, Ohio/Elder) in the 184lb class. McCloud took care of business in the first period pinning his opponent 1:12 into the match. In the 197lb weight class
Cookie Armstrong (Dayton, Ohio/Alter) followed McCloud pinning his opponent 2:23 into the first round. To cap off the first match in the heavyweight class
Michael Addis (Norwood, Ohio/Norwood) beat the buzzer with a pin 2:59 into the first period giving the Lions the 58-0 victory.
MSJ - 44 Rio Grande - 9
The Lions got their second match started with
Jorden Zigo (Dayton, Ohio/Trotwood Madison) in the 125lb class. Zigo controlled the riding time early in the match defeating his opponent 10-5 to give the Lions an early 3-0 lead. After two forfeits from Rio Grande the Lions would drop a match but still held the lead 15-6. The next man up to wrestle for the Lions was 157lb
Roger Dylan Deck (Hamilton, Ohio/Hamilton). Deck dominated the first period going up 6-3 and then pinned his opponent in the 2nd period at 4:33 extending the Lions lead to 21-6.
The Lions would drop another match but the #1 174lb wrestler in Division III
Cornell Beachem (Cincinnati, Ohio/Winton Woods) would step to the mat. Beachem worked quickly defeating his opponent by technical fall 20-5 in the first period. Following Beachem was
Antonio McCloud who was even quicker. McCloud pinned his opponent just 32 seconds into the match giving the Lions a commanding 32-9 lead. After a forfeit from Rio Grande in the 197lb weight class
Bradley Smith (Beavercreek, Ohio/Beavercreek) stepped to the mat to round out the meet. Smith was dominant going up 8-1 before pinning his opponent 2:47 in the first round. After the official match was over
Dylan Deck stepped to the mat again to wrestle a consolation match vs Rio Grande's Ryan Troyer. Deck didn't waste any time pinning Troyer just 1:14 into the first round earning the win.
